    Where to Find AirPods Monthly Payment Plans

    Now that you're sold on the idea, let's talk about where you can actually snag a monthly payment plan for your AirPods. The good news is, there are several options out there, so you've got some choices! First and foremost, Apple itself is a fantastic place to start. They often offer financing options through their website or in-store. This means you can directly purchase your AirPods and spread the cost over several months. Apple's plans are usually straightforward and easy to manage, often integrated with your Apple ID or linked to your existing Apple accounts. Then, there are the major retailers. Big names like Best Buy, Amazon, and Walmart frequently have installment plans available for AirPods. These retailers often partner with financial institutions to provide these options. Check their websites or visit their stores to see what plans they offer. These retailers often provide several options, so be sure to browse them all. Another great option is wireless carriers. Companies like AT&T, Verizon, and T-Mobile often offer AirPods as part of their device financing plans. If you're already a customer, it can be convenient to bundle your AirPods with your phone plan and pay for everything in one place. Keep an eye out for promotions and deals that might make the offer even sweeter. So, whether you prefer the direct route with Apple or want to explore other options through major retailers and carriers, finding a monthly payment plan for your AirPods is easier than you think.     Comparing Payment Plan Providers for AirPods

    Choosing the right payment plan provider for your AirPods involves a bit of research, but it's well worth the effort to ensure you get the best deal. Start by comparing interest rates. Some plans come with interest, while others may offer a 0% APR (Annual Percentage Rate) for a limited time. Obviously, a 0% APR is the most attractive option because you won't be paying any extra on top of the original price. Also, look at the length of the payment terms. Plans can range from a few months to a couple of years. Consider your budget and how quickly you want to pay off your AirPods. Shorter terms mean higher monthly payments but less interest overall, while longer terms mean lower monthly payments but more interest. Be sure to check the eligibility requirements. Some plans require a credit check, and your approval will depend on your credit score. Be aware of any hidden fees. Some providers may charge late payment fees, early payoff fees, or other charges that can increase the overall cost. Read the fine print carefully and understand all the associated costs before you sign up. Compare the customer service and return policies of each provider. You'll want to choose a provider that's easy to contact and offers a clear and fair return policy in case something goes wrong with your AirPods. When you have all the information, you are ready to choose your AirPods payment plan provider. Comparing your options will ultimately help you make the right choice.

    Understanding the Terms and Conditions

    Before you jump into a payment plan, it's super important to understand the terms and conditions. I know, I know, reading the fine print isn't the most exciting thing, but trust me, it can save you a lot of headaches down the road. First off, carefully review the interest rate (APR). As we mentioned earlier, some plans have interest, and it can significantly increase the total cost of your AirPods over time. Look for plans with a 0% APR if possible, or shop around to find the lowest rate available. Payment terms are another crucial aspect. Make sure you understand how long you'll be making payments and the amount of each payment. Ensure the monthly payments fit comfortably within your budget. Late payment penalties are something to watch out for. Most plans charge fees for late payments, and these can add up quickly. Set up automatic payments to avoid missing deadlines, or at least keep a close eye on your due dates. Early payoff options can save you money. If you have extra cash, see if you can pay off your AirPods early without incurring any penalties. This can help you avoid interest charges and save you money in the long run. Also, pay attention to the default terms. Understand what happens if you miss several payments or can't fulfill your obligations. This could involve repossession of the AirPods and damage to your credit score. Grasping these terms and conditions will ensure you enter your payment plan with your eyes wide open and avoid any unpleasant surprises. Knowledge is power, so take the time to read the fine print!

    Potential Issues and How to Resolve Them

    Even with the best intentions, things can sometimes go sideways with a payment plan. Let's talk about some potential issues and how to handle them. Missed Payments. If you miss a payment, act fast. Contact your provider immediately and explain the situation. See if you can set up a payment arrangement to catch up. Don't ignore the problem, as it can lead to late fees and damage your credit. Payment Disputes. If you believe there's an error in your bill, such as an incorrect charge, contact your provider and dispute the charge. Gather any supporting documentation, like receipts or statements, to support your case. Keep track of the communication and follow up until the issue is resolved. Financial Hardship. If you face unexpected financial challenges, reach out to your provider right away. They might offer options like temporarily reducing your payments or pausing your payments altogether. Explain your situation and work with them to find a solution. Lost or Stolen AirPods. In case you lose your AirPods, you're still responsible for your monthly payments. Check your warranty or insurance to see if you're covered for replacements. However, it's your responsibility to continue making payments. Also, if your AirPods get stolen, report the theft to the police and contact your provider. If you encounter any problems, always be proactive and communicate with your provider. Taking quick action will help mitigate the impact and keep your payment plan on track. Handling these issues properly will ensure a positive experience and minimize the financial impact.
